
This chapter book introduces young readers to Ginger Breadhouse, a student at Ever After High, a magical boarding school where the children of famous fairy tale characters are destined to relive their parents' stories. Ginger, the daughter of the infamous Candy Witch from Hansel and Gretel, struggles with her predetermined path to be a villain. Instead, she dreams of becoming a kind pastry chef with her own cooking show. The story explores themes of identity, self-determination, and the courage to forge one's own destiny, set against a backdrop of whimsical fairy tale characters navigating modern high school life. It's an engaging read for children aged 4-11, particularly those interested in fairy tales and stories about finding your unique path.
